Output 5babdb77524c3aa7e91b31d94775d583e6ba1d84565790059af1aa202aa08a15:0

value
556365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ef449495138676723aabb5792896cb02ce0ffa0 OP_EQUAL
address
3EitX6GU4s5wNVnQbk8WRTzcdWhUHLvwVX
transaction
5babdb77524c3aa7e91b31d94775d583e6ba1d84565790059af1aa202aa08a15
confirmations
150053
spent
true